Output cd6e6f60ba2160df36bb8d09fc4e50bbdbf96ac2c29152a018d9fa27081f27dd:1

value
17364530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b7690386b3deff0a3d27c24a28a8f932091c99f OP_EQUAL
address
3LEq8QrSFNPWf9jjxqZcYSUrH8YzQqtuKw
transaction
cd6e6f60ba2160df36bb8d09fc4e50bbdbf96ac2c29152a018d9fa27081f27dd
confirmations
339638
spent
true